Pertemps Swindon, have gone from strength to strength and due to their continued success are looking to take on a recruitment consultant specialising in Technical and Engineering (non IT). The successful candidate will play a pivotal role in sourcing, screening, and placing well qualified candidates into temporary and/or permanent positions within various engineering and manufacturing sectors.Having excellent communication and interpersonal skills are essential as you will be building strong relationships with both our clients and candidates. You will also need to be detail orientated with the ability to manage multiple responsibilities to ensure excellent customer service and ultimately a seamless recruitment process.Responsibilities:
  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with key clients in the technical and engineering sector.
  • Understand clients' hiring needs, company culture, and strategic goals to provide tailored recruitment solutions.
  • Proactively source, identify, and attract high-calibre candidates through various channels, including job boards, social media, and networking events.
  • Conduct thorough pre-screening calls and interviews to evaluate candidates' skills, experience, and cultural fit.
  • Create job descriptions and adverts to inform potential candidates of opportunities.
  • Visit client sites to gain insights into how their business works.
Requirements:
  • A full UK driving licence is required.
  • Proven experience in a sales or customer centric role preferably within an office or professional services environment. Or a background within the Engineering sector with a passion and drive to sales.
  • Excellent professional telephone manner when speaking to stakeholders at various levels.
  • Commercial awareness and knowledge of local businesses is advantageous
  • Commun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Results-driven mindset with a track record of meeting and exceeding targets.
  • Ability to build and maintain strong client and candidate relationships.
